Cultural diversity is a term that has gained significant attention over the years. In a world where globalization has brought people closer, cultural diversity has become an essential aspect of society. It refers to the existence of different cultures and ethnicities in a particular place, which contributes significantly to its uniqueness and identity. Cultural diversity plays a critical role in shaping the society we live in, and its significance and value cannot be downplayed.

One of the most significant benefits of cultural diversity is the promotion of mutual understanding and respect. When individuals from different cultures interact, they get to learn about each other’s practices, beliefs, and traditions. This leads to the breaking down of prejudices and negative stereotypes that may exist, and promotes cultural appreciation. Interacting with people from diverse cultures allows individuals to see things from a different perspective, promoting empathy and tolerance.

Cultural diversity also promotes creativity and innovation. When people from different backgrounds come together, they bring with them their unique experiences, skills, and knowledge. This diversity of thought promotes creativity and fosters innovation in various sectors, including business, science, arts, and technology. Organizations that embrace cultural diversity are more likely to develop a unique competitive advantage and achieve higher levels of productivity and profitability.

In addition, cultural diversity enhances social cohesion. It allows people from different backgrounds to come together and form a common bond, contributing to a more cohesive and united society. This cohesion is essential in promoting peace and stability, as it helps to reduce tensions and conflicts that may arise due to cultural differences.

However, promoting cultural diversity requires deliberate efforts from individuals, organizations, and governments. It involves creating an environment that is open and inclusive of people from different cultural backgrounds. This could involve the adoption of policies that promote diversity and inclusion or creating awareness campaigns to promote cultural appreciation.

In conclusion, the significance and value of cultural diversity cannot be overemphasized. It promotes mutual understanding and respect, creativity and innovation, social cohesion, and overall contributes to a more vibrant and enriched society. Embracing cultural diversity requires effort from everyone, but the benefits that come with it are undoubtedly worth it.
